Transaction

3ba37e880e6010680c3347b0977e4e44770482acd02ab1a497d960814a05d09a

Summary

In Block699984
TimeThu, 16 May 2024 14:57:15 UTC
Total Input801.6230463 Nebula
Total Output835.6230463 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
192696 Confirmations835.6230463 Nebula
Raw Transaction